+/*
+ * RSS Query and Configuration API.
+ */
+
+/** RSS object info. */
+struct rte_swx_ctl_rss_info {
+ /** RSS object name. */
+ char name[RTE_SWX_CTL_NAME_SIZE];
+};
+
+/**
+ * RSS object info get
+ *
+ * @param[in] p
+ * Pipeline handle.
+ * @param[in] rss_obj_id
+ * RSS object ID (0 .. *n_rss* - 1).
+ * @param[out] rss
+ * RSS object info.
+ * @return
+ * 0 on success or the following error codes otherwise:
+ * -EINVAL: Invalid argument.
+ */
+__rte_experimental
+int
+rte_swx_ctl_rss_info_get(struct rte_swx_pipeline *p,
+ uint32_t rss_obj_id,
+ struct rte_swx_ctl_rss_info *rss);
+
+/**
+ * RSS object key size read
+ *
+ * @param[in] p
+ * Pipeline handle.
+ * @param[in] rss_name
+ * RSS object name.
+ * @param[out] key_size
+ * RSS key size in bytes.
+ * @return
+ * 0 on success or the following error codes otherwise:
+ * -EINVAL: Invalid argument.
+ */
+__rte_experimental
+int
+rte_swx_ctl_pipeline_rss_key_size_read(struct rte_swx_pipeline *p,
+ const char *rss_name,
+ uint32_t *key_size);
+
+/**
+ * RSS object key read
+ *
+ * @param[in] p
+ * Pipeline handle.
+ * @param[in] rss_name
+ * RSS object name.
+ * @param[out] key
+ * RSS key. Must be pre-allocated by the caller to store *key_size* bytes.
+ * @return
+ * 0 on success or the following error codes otherwise:
+ * -EINVAL: Invalid argument.
+ */
+__rte_experimental
+int
+rte_swx_ctl_pipeline_rss_key_read(struct rte_swx_pipeline *p,
+ const char *rss_name,
+ uint8_t *key);
+
+/**
+ * RSS object key write
+ *
+ * @param[in] p
+ * Pipeline handle.
+ * @param[in] rss_name
+ * RSS object name.
+ * @param[in] key_size
+ * RSS key size in bytes. Must be at least 4 and a power of 2.
+ * @param[in] key
+ * RSS key.
+ * @return
+ * 0 on success or the following error codes otherwise:
+ * -EINVAL: Invalid argument.
+ */
+__rte_experimental
+int
+rte_swx_ctl_pipeline_rss_key_write(struct rte_swx_pipeline *p,
+ const char *rss_name,
+ uint32_t key_size,
+ uint8_t *key);
+

+/*
+ * rss.
+ */
+static inline uint32_t
+rss_func(uint32_t *key, uint32_t key_size, uint32_t *data, uint32_t data_size)
+{
+ uint32_t hash_val = 0, key_mask = key_size - 1, i;
+
+ for (i = 0; i < data_size; i++) {
+ uint32_t d;
+
+ for (d = data[i]; d; d &= (d - 1)) {
+ uint32_t key0, key1, pos;
+
+ pos = rte_bsf32(d);
+ key0 = key[i & key_mask] << (31 - pos);
+ key1 = key[(i + 1) & key_mask] >> (pos + 1);
+ hash_val ^= key0 | key1;
+ }
+ }
+
+ return hash_val;
+}
+
+static inline void
+__instr_rss_exec(struct rte_swx_pipeline *p,
+ struct thread *t,
+ const struct instruction *ip)
+{
+ uint32_t rss_obj_id = ip->rss.rss_obj_id;
+ uint32_t dst_offset = ip->rss.dst.offset;
+ uint32_t n_dst_bits = ip->rss.dst.n_bits;
+ uint32_t src_struct_id = ip->rss.src.struct_id;
+ uint32_t src_offset = ip->rss.src.offset;
+ uint32_t n_src_bytes = ip->rss.src.n_bytes;
+
+ struct rss_runtime *r = p->rss_runtime[rss_obj_id];
+ uint8_t *src_ptr = t->structs[src_struct_id];
+ uint32_t result;
+
+ TRACE("[Thread %2u] rss %u\n",
+ p->thread_id,
+ rss_obj_id);
+
+ result = rss_func(r->key, r->key_size, (uint32_t *)&src_ptr[src_offset], n_src_bytes >> 2);
+ METADATA_WRITE(t, dst_offset, n_dst_bits, result);
+}
+
